The Iris Pro Graphics 6200 is at least 2x slower gaming GPU than the GeForce RTX 2080. We cannot compare value as at least one GPU is out of stock.
Advantages of the Iris Pro Graphics 6200
- Consumes up to 93% less energy – 15 vs 215 Watts
Advantages of the GeForce RTX 2080
- At least 2x faster GPU for gaming

Specifications
Comparison of all specifications
Iris Pro Graphics 6200 | SpecificationsComparison of all specifications | GeForce RTX 2080 |
---|---|---|
General | ||
Sep 5th, 2014 | Release Date | Sep 20th, 2018 |
Not Available | MSRP | $699.00 |
HD Graphics | Generation | GeForce 20 |
Integrated | Segment | Desktop |
15 W | Power Consumption | 215 W |
Memory | ||
System-Shared | Memory Size | 8 GB |
System-Shared | Memory Type | GDDR6 |
System-Shared | Memory Bus | 256-bit |
System-Shared | Bandwidth | 448 GB/s |
Theoretical Performance | ||
6.6 GPixel/s | Pixel Fillrate | 109.4 GPixel/s |
52.8 GTexel/s | Texture Fillrate | 314.6 GTexel/s |
844.8 GFLOPS | FP32 | 10.07 TFLOPS |
